Frequently asked questions about hotels in Fermanagh

  • What are the best landmarks to visit in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    Fermanagh boasts some stunning landmarks. Definitely check out the magnificent Enniskillen Castle, perched on an island in the Erne River. For breathtaking scenery, a visit to Lough Erne is a must; consider a boat tour to explore its many islands and hidden bays. Marble Arch Caves Global Geopark offers fascinating underground cave systems and walking trails. Also worth considering is Devenish Island, with its monastic ruins and stunning views across Lough Erne.

  • What is the best itinerary to experience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    A three-day itinerary could work well. Day one: Explore Enniskillen, visiting the castle and the town centre. Day two: Take a boat trip on Lough Erne, perhaps visiting Devenish Island. Day three: Discover the Marble Arch Caves Global Geopark, enjoying the walking trails and the underground caves. This is just a suggestion; you can easily adapt it based on your interests and available time.

  • What is the best time to visit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    The best time to visit is during the summer months (June to August) for warm weather and long daylight hours, ideal for exploring the outdoors. However, sp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and fewer crowds. Winter can be cold and wet, but it has its own charm, particularly for those who enjoy a quieter experience.

  • What traditional local food should you try in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    You should sample some hearty Irish stew, a classic comfort food. Fresh seafood from Lough Erne is also a must-try, often served in local restaurants. Traditional soda bread, baked with baking soda instead of yeast, is another local favourite.

  • What should visitors know about the weather and natural risks in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    Fermanagh's weather is changeable, with rain possible at any time of year. Pack layers of clothing and waterproofs. While generally safe, be aware of the potential for strong winds near Lough Erne, especially during the autumn and winter months. Always check weather forecasts before embarking on outdoor activities.
  • Are there any special items you’ll need when travelling to Fermanagh, United Kingdom?

    Comfortable walking shoes are essential, given the amount of walking you might do, especially if exploring the countryside or visiting the Marble Arch Caves. Waterproof and windproof outer layers are also advisable, given the unpredictable weather. Insect repellent can be useful during the summer months.
